suit 指“适合,中意,适宜”,多指符合需要、口味、性格、条件、场合等。尤其用来指衣服的样式、颜色或发式与人相配
fit 是一个日常用语,多用来指“大小、形状、尺寸等合适”
match 指“相配,配得上”,指人或物在性质、色调、设计等方面相当或相配

引 导 词 用 法 例 句
从属
连词 that,
whether
(不能用if) 在从句中不作成分,that没有实际意义,不可省略;whether意为“是否” The trouble is that I have lost his address.
麻烦是我把他的地址丢了。
The point at issue is whether we go to the party.
争论点是我们是否去参加聚会。
引 导 词 用 法 例 句
从属
连词 because 说明主语所表示的事件发生的原因,意为“因为” He has heart disease. That is because he has been smoking too much.
他有心脏病。那是因为他抽烟太多。
as if/though 从句表示的情况发生的可能性较小时常用虚拟语气 It seems as if he doesn't know the answer.
他好像不知道答案。
引 导 词 用 法 例 句
连接代词 who(ever),
whom(ever),
whose,
what(ever),
which(ever)等 在从句中作主语、宾语、表语、定语等 Every year, whoever makes the most beautiful kite will win a prize in the Kite Festival.
(2017·北京高考)
每年,在风筝节上风筝做得最漂亮的人将赢得一份奖品。
连接副词 when,where,why,how等 在从句中作状语,表示时间、地点、原因、方式等 The last time we had great fun was when we were visiting the Water Park.
我们最后一次开心地游玩是我们参观水上公园的时候。

易混词 语气强弱 所作成分 主语 句型
probable 语气最强 作表语或定语 作表语时,常用it作形式主语 It is probable that ...
likely 语气较possible强,较probable弱 作表语 作表语时,主语为人、物或形式主语it Sb./Sth. is likely to do sth.
It is likely that ...
possible 语气最弱 作表语或定语 作表语时,常用it作形式主语 It is possible for sb. to do sth. It is possible that ...
